Cylinder Block Distortion

NOTE:
Refer to the appropriate ENGINE article for the specification.
- Use a straightedge and a feeler gauge to inspect the cylinder block for flatness.
NOTE:
Use a straightedge that is calibrated by the manufacturer to be flat within 0.005 mm (0.0002 in) per running foot of length, such as Snap-On® GA438A or equivalent. For example, if the straightedge is 61 cm (24 in) long, the machined edge must be flat within 0.010 mm (0.0004 in) from end to end.
